New House picks committee to reply to Speech from the Throne

The new Lower House's Permanent Office Saturday named a thirty-member committee that will write the reply to His Majesty King Abdullah's speech from the throne opening the 19th Jordanian parliament.

The legislature will send the reply within two weeks of the inaugural speech, which the King delivered on Thursday.

In its first meeting, which was chaired by House Speaker MP Abdul Muneim Odat, the Permanent Office set the parliament's priorities in the next stage.

Odat thanked the King for the inauguration of parliament's first extraordinary session "in these exceptional circumstances we are experiencing due to the COVID-19 pandemic."

He called for enhancing the legislature's performance to meet the aspirations of Jordanians, pledging to address "the imbalances" that offered a negative image about the legislative institution, and remain closely attached to citizens' issues and take their complaints and grievances into consideration.

The House chief also called on lawmakers under the dome and during the committees' meetings to adhere to distancing and other COVID-19 preventive measures.
